WebCalifornia Vehicle Code section 21717: Turning Across Bicycle Lane states that cars are required to enter the bike lane before turning.. Both the approach for a right-hand turn and a right-hand turn shall be made as close as practicable to the right-hand curb or edge of the roadway except: (1) WebCoyote Creek Neighbors sent us a message asking for clarification on turning right on red lights. According to CVC 21453(a), A red circular signal requires a motorists to stop completely before the stop limit line and proceed only after given a green signal. In CVC 21453(b), at a red circular signal, a motorists may turn right after stopping completely …

WebIn most left-turn cases, a police officer who responds to the accident scene will take a report and issue a traffic citation to the party turning left for failure to yield the right of way. However, in disputed left-turn accident cases, it is often necessary to employ an expert in accident reconstruction to prove who was at fault for the accident.

Bicyclists must travel on the right side of the roadway in the direction of traffic, except when passing, making a legal left turn, riding on a one-way street, riding on a road that is too narrow, or when the right side of the road is closed due to road construction. VEH 21650.
